Technology in Motion: How Robotic-Assisted Surgery is Reshaping the Artificial Joint Market

0
2

The Artificial Joint Market is undergoing a technological revolution, with robotic-assisted surgery emerging as a key trend. Unlike traditional manual procedures, robotic-assisted surgery uses a robotic arm or navigation system to enhance the surgeon's precision and control during the operation. The surgeon remains in full control, but the robot provides real-time data and guidance, allowing for more accurate bone preparation and precise implant placement. This technology is particularly valuable in complex cases and is helping to reduce the risk of human error.

The growing adoption of robotic-assisted surgery is fueled by its potential to improve patient outcomes. Studies have shown that it can lead to more accurate implant positioning, which in turn can increase the longevity of the prosthetic joint and reduce the risk of revision surgeries. Additionally, the enhanced precision often allows for a less invasive approach, which can lead to reduced tissue damage, less blood loss, and a faster recovery time for the patient. For surgeons, the technology provides a powerful tool for pre-operative planning and intra-operative guidance, improving confidence and consistency.

While the initial cost of robotic systems can be high, the long-term benefits in terms of improved patient satisfaction and reduced complication rates are making it an increasingly attractive investment for hospitals and surgical centers. As the technology becomes more widely available and its benefits more well-known, robotic-assisted surgery is set to become a standard of care in the orthopedic world. This innovation not only boosts the market for surgical systems but also reinforces the demand for high-quality artificial joints that can be precisely placed for optimal performance.

FAQs

  • Q: What is robotic-assisted surgery for joint replacement? A: It is a surgical procedure where a surgeon uses a robotic arm or computer navigation system to assist with precise bone cutting and implant placement, improving accuracy and outcomes.

  • Q: What are the main benefits of this technology? A: The main benefits include more precise implant positioning, reduced tissue damage, and potentially faster patient recovery times.
